Wireless communication apparatus processing intermittent data
First Claim
1. A wireless communication apparatus having a wireless processing part for processing a wireless signal including intermittent data and a base band signal processing part for receiving/transmitting said intermittent data to/from said wireless processing part, wherein said base band signal processing part comprises:
- a plurality of signal processing blocks having different signal processing periods;
a buffer memory which is provided between said plurality of signal processing blocks;
a clock control part which supplies a clock signal to each of said plurality of signal processing blocks and said buffer memory;
a power source control part which supplies a power source to each of said plurality of signal processing parts and said buffer memory; and
a control engine which controls said plurality of signal processing blocks, said buffer memory, said clock control part, and said power source control part, and at least one of said plurality of signal processing blocks has means for watching which watches whether or not there is data to be processed in the subsequent signal processing block having the different signal processing period, and said control engine also controls said clock control part to supply or suspend the clock signal to said subsequent signal processing block based on a watched result of said means for watching.
4 Assignments
0 Petitions
Accused Products
Abstract
In order to effectively reduce power consumption of a terminal in a wireless communication apparatus upon packet communication, the wireless communication apparatus has a plurality of signal processing blocks having different signal processing periods; a buffer memory which links the signal processing blocks; and a clock control part which supplies or suspends a clock signal to each block. Each of the signal processing blocks watches whether or not there is data to be processed in the subsequent signal processing block. Based on the watched result, the clock control part controls an operation to supply or suspend the clock signal to the subsequent signal processing block.
44 Citations
8 Claims
-
1. A wireless communication apparatus having a wireless processing part for processing a wireless signal including intermittent data and a base band signal processing part for receiving/transmitting said intermittent data to/from said wireless processing part, wherein said base band signal processing part comprises:
-
a plurality of signal processing blocks having different signal processing periods;
a buffer memory which is provided between said plurality of signal processing blocks;
a clock control part which supplies a clock signal to each of said plurality of signal processing blocks and said buffer memory;
a power source control part which supplies a power source to each of said plurality of signal processing parts and said buffer memory; and
a control engine which controls said plurality of signal processing blocks, said buffer memory, said clock control part, and said power source control part, and at least one of said plurality of signal processing blocks has means for watching which watches whether or not there is data to be processed in the subsequent signal processing block having the different signal processing period, and said control engine also controls said clock control part to supply or suspend the clock signal to said subsequent signal processing block based on a watched result of said means for watching. - View Dependent Claims (2, 3, 4, 5, 6)
said at least one of signal processing blocks watches the existence of said user data portion and, when there is not said user data portion as the watched result, said control engine controls said clock control part to supply or suspend the clock signal to said at least one of signal processing blocks over a period in which said user data portion is to be processed. -
4. A wireless communication apparatus according to claim 3, wherein said control engine further has means for controlling said power source control part to control the power source to be supplied to said subsequent signal processing block based on said watched result.
-
5. A wireless communication apparatus according to claim 1, wherein said intermittent data comprises a signal with a signal format including a periodic control data portion and a user data portion, is a signal that a control signal is periodically transmitted when there is not user data portion, and is a signal to suspend said periodic control data portion when there is not said user data portion sequentially a predetermined times or more, and
said control engine controls said clock control part to supply or suspend the clock signal for a period in which the control signal is to be processed to at least one of said plurality of signal processing blocks based on said watched result. -
6. A wireless communication apparatus according to claim 5, wherein said control engine further controls said power source part to control the power source to be supplied to said subsequent signal processing block based on said watched result.
-
-
7. A large scale integrated circuit comprising:
-
a plurality of signal processing blocks having different signal processing periods;
a buffer memory which is provided between said plurality of signal processing blocks;
a clock control part which supplies a clock signal to each of said plurality of signal processing blocks and said buffer memory;
a power source control part which supplies a power source to each of said plurality of signal processing blocks and said buffer memory; and
a control engine which controls said plurality of signal processing blocks, said buffer memory, said clock control part, and said power source control part, wherein at least one of said plurality of signal processing blocks has means for watching which watches whether or not there is data to be processed in the subsequent signal processing block having the different processing period, and said control engine has means for controlling said clock control part to supply or suspend the clock signal to said subsequent signal processing block based on a watched result of said means for watching. - View Dependent Claims (8)
-
Specification